Quick Mail Project is Mail Server with Web mail. The project is independed platform support designed Using Java ,C, PHP ,MySQL database . Its support RFC SMTP protocol , RFC Internet Message, Multi domains, forward, block, spam bulk and a lot more.
A POP3 and IMAP management system that can be used for administration, run as a public webmail system, or used as a private webmail to enable access to POP3 and IMAP accounts through a web site.

Webmail project, based on the original UebiMiau, that uses the newer smarty template engine, better optimized, have export / import of addressbook, most things rewritten, many new features.
This project (pb.WebMAUI) (Web-Mail Administration User Interface) aims at building a web-based administration tool for managing:
complex maildomains
mail user accounts
server based filtering incl. \\\"out-of-office mail replies\\\".

PHP IMSP Client Classes -
a set of PHP classes to work with an IMSP (Interactive Messaging Support Protocol) Server via PHP4. To allow a custom "webmail" application access to an IMSP store.

Web Interface to mail list threads. This project provedes functional tools to the mail list users can navigate through threads given them scores or comments.
TiM is an email client written in PHP with a MySQL backend for storing mail. It can currently retrieve messages from POP3 accounts. Files released on project homepage.

This project will enable users on an intranet having a webserver and a database to send , recive and reply to memos. The memos can also be sent along with attachments. The system is fully configurable and will run on windows and linux servers alike.

Encki Mail is a web based e-mail system that focusses on ease of use for both the user and the system administrator. The project is being developed for Linux using the popular PHP + MySQL combination.
